Apply Now: VACE Project Grant & Support Program for Nigerian Ginger and Tomato Processors

Every year, tons of Nigerian ginger and tomatoes go to waste or sit on market stalls selling for a fraction of what they are worth.

If you are a processor, baker, or beverage producer looking to stop raw agricultural potential from slipping through your fingers, a direct path is now available to turn those raw crops into high-margin, shelf-ready products.

Through hands-on technical guidance, product development assistance, and direct market access, the Value Chain for Agribusiness, Climate and Employment (VACE) Project is accepting applications from Nigerian SMEs ready to build commercially viable ginger and tomato products.

Women-led and youth-owned businesses are strongly encouraged to apply.

Key Support & Program Benefits

  • Product Development & Recipe Refinement: Expert technical guidance to improve processing methods, refine recipes, and prepare innovative ginger and tomato products for store shelves.
  • Direct Buyer & Market Exposure: Opportunities to showcase your products at trade exhibitions to connect with major buyers, investors, and strategic industry partners.
  • Business Growth Services: Specialized advice covering enterprise growth planning, market positioning, and commercial strategy.

Qualification Requirements

To be eligible for this program, your enterprise must meet the following criteria:

  • Industry Experience: At least 3 years of active experience in ginger or tomato processing.
  • Business Registration: Legally registered (or able to present proof of an ongoing registration process).
  • Existing Market Reach: At least one active marketing or sales channel currently in place.
  • Innovation Mindset: A commitment to launch at least one new product and a willingness to share recipes as part of the technical support process.

Priority Target Regions

Applications are actively prioritized for processors based in the following states:

  • Kaduna State
  • Kano State
  • Plateau State
  • Kebbi State

Qualified enterprises operating in Lagos State and the Federal Capital Territory (Abuja) are also eligible to apply.

How to Apply

  1. Request the Official Concept Form: Send a short email to the GIZ project coordinator at flora.asibe@giz.de with the subject line "Request for VACE Project Concept Form – [Your Business Name]".
  2. Complete Your Proposal: Fill in the Concept Form detailing your processing history, registration status, and your proposed ginger or tomato product idea.
  3. Submit: Return your completed concept note via email to flora.asibe@giz.de before the deadline on Friday, August 7, 2026.
